GLOVE STANDARDS

EN388:2016+A1:2018 - Mechanical Hazards
Protection against mechanical hazards in respect of physical and mechanical stress caused by abrasion, blade cut, tear and puncture. The table below indicates the glove’s resistance to:
4 = Abrasion
X = Blade Cut* (coup)
4 = Tear
2 = Puncture
F = Straight Blade Cut (EN ISO 13997)
NOTES:
Where 1 indicates the lowest performance. X that the test was not performed or not possible. A 0 rating indicates that during the test level 1 was not reached.
*Gloves should not be used when working with serrated blades

EN374-1:2016+A1:2018 - Chemical Hazards
The chemicals break through the glove material at a molecular level. The breakthrough time is here evaluated and the glove must withstand a breakthrough time of at least 30 minutes against a minimum of 6 test chemicals.
J = n-heptane (142-82-5) Saturated hydrocarbon
K = 40% Sodium hydroxide (1310-73-2) Inorganic base
L = 96% Sulphuric acid (7664-93-9) Inorganic base
M = 65% Nitric acid (7697-32-2) Inorganic base
N = 99% Acetic acid (64-19-7) Organic acid
O = 25% Ammonium hydroxide (1336-21-6) Inorganic base

EN407:2020 - Thermal risks (heat and/or fire)
This standard specifies thermal performance for protective gloves against heat and/or fire. The table below indicates the glove’s resistance to:
X = Flammability
1 = Contact heat
X = Convective heat
X = Radiant heat
X = Small splashes of molten metal
X = Large splashes of molten metal
NOTES: Where 1 indicates the lowest performance. X that the test was not performed or not possible. A 0 rating indicates that during the test level 1 was not reached.

GLOVE STORY
Who this glove was designed for
The following industry sectors where extreme environments mean that hands require superior safety:
- Oil & gas – particularly those who work offshore
- Petrochemical, agrichemical and chemical
- Construction – concreting, piling
- Utilities
- Wastewater
Why we developed this glove
In these extreme environments, there are multiple risks at hand; from handling sharp components that are likely wet or oily, to risk of liquid or chemical splashes or leakages. We identified there wasn’t a single glove that could protect hands across such a wide range of risks.
The solution
The Rayza RX575 gauntlet is designed to protect on every front. In fact, it surpasses the industry standards for combined chemical, heat and cut protection.
The Rayza RX575 combines maximum cut protection (index F) with a superior nitrile barrier; resistant to multiple chemicals (including resistance to Heptane, a bi-product of petroleum), oils, fungi and bacteria. Also certified for contact level 1 heat resistance, the increased length compared to a typical gauntlet ensures protection for the lower arm too.
